For the past 50 years, every attempt to start a new professional football league has faced the same problem. Though football is far and away America’s most popular sport, there is simply no evidence that enough people want to spend enough time watching a minor-league version to make it financially viable over the long-term.

That’s why it was curious Tuesday when the startup Alliance of American Football announced that billionaire entrepreneur and Carolina Hurricanes owner Tom Dundon laid down $250 million to become the league’s chairman amid reports it was already in danger of running out of money after just two weeks of play.

Dundon’s emergency bailout of the league, which nearly missed its first week’s payroll according to Darren Rovell of the Action Network, comes with a pretty important question: What, exactly, is he getting for his $250 million?
